Jimmy Two Times has made a relatively seamless transition to fences and commands respect as he seeks to follow up his Downpatrick beginners chase success in stronger company, whilst Call it Magic should be sharper for a recent spin over hurdles at Cork, has the blinkers applied, the benefit of Ruby Walsh aboard, and appears a worthy adversary. However, the standout contender is the improving NET D'ECOSSE. He has been very competitive all summer with cut in the ground, and whilst probably just struggling to get home over a longer trip at Kilbeggan last month, a reproduction of that form, or his previous 1¾L Galway third to Riviera Sun, ought to prove strong enough.
